About B. Boden

B. Boden is a scholar working on Oceanography, Ecology, Global and Planetary Change, Spectroscopy and Molecular Biology, having authored 23 papers that have together received 540 indexed citations. Recurring topics across this work include Marine Biology and Ecology Research (5 papers), Marine animal studies overview (4 papers), Marine and fisheries research (4 papers), Marine and coastal ecosystems (4 papers), Crustacean biology and ecology (4 papers), Isotope Analysis in Ecology (3 papers), Advanced NMR Techniques and Applications (3 papers) and Atomic and Subatomic Physics Research (2 papers). The work is most often cited by research in Oceanography (278 citations), Global and Planetary Change (209 citations), Ecology (234 citations), Nature and Landscape Conservation (70 citations) and Nuclear and High Energy Physics (58 citations). B. Boden has collaborated with scholars based in United States, Germany and South Africa. Frequent co-authors include Elizabeth M. Kampa, Edward Brinton, B. R. Allanson, Martin W. Johnson, B. C. Abbott, John H. Day, V. D. Burkert, G. Knop, Renzo Perissinotto and R. R. Sauerwein. Their work appears in journals such as Nature, Limnology and Oceanography, The European Physical Journal C, Polar Biology and Transactions of the Royal Society of South Africa.
